页游B/S (Browser Server)浏览器/服务器:
优点:不用单独安装客户端和更新包。
缺点:画质差
端游C/S(Client Server)客户端/服务器:
安装客户端、更新需要使用更新包。所有用户都需要安装更新包。
优点:利用计算机全部的性能
前端开发:
HTML:Hyper-Text Markup Language(超文本标记语言)
超文本:在普通文本基础上,可以添加视频、音频等资源。
标记:是有特殊意义的特殊符号 <table> 标签 元素
语言:
语法规则:
1、html文件是有各种标记(标签组成的),标签是使用<>包裹字符形成的
2、html文件是有格式的:
<html> <head></head> <body></body> </html>
3、html中的注释使用 `<!-- 这是注释 -->`
4、html中的标签可以分为块元素标签和内联元素标签
5、html中的标签可以单标签和成对出现的标签两种。<br><p>包裹内容</p>
6、html中标签可以有属性,属性是键值对类型的,属性的键和值之间使用=分割,值需要使用引号引住
<a href="http://www.baidu.com">这是一个超链接</a>
7、标签可以嵌套,但不能交叉嵌套 <a><span>这是文字</a></span>
按照显示效果划分
html的默认布局方式:流式布局
块元素标签:独占一行,不管上面行是否放满
内联样式(行内样式)标签:如果上面没有满就继续放,满了另起一行。
常用的标签:
排版标签:
<h1> ~ <h6>
<p>
<br> 换行
<div>: 就是一个框,什么都能往里装,默认没有样式。块级元素。
<span>:就是一个框,什么都能往里装,默认没有样式。内联元素。
字符实体:
< <
> >
空格 。
注意:html中任意多的空格和换行都会解析成一个空格
超链接标签:
<a>
href: 填写链接地址
图片标签:
<img>
src: 图片的地址
注意:超链接标签与图片标签的链接属性不一样